Whenever I change the sensitivity settings in the portal 2 config file and then enter the game, they change back to some default setting. Is there any way of avoiding this?

I changed the setting and then made it read only. When I close the game and go into the config file it has the right sensitivity permanently, but when I enter the game it definitely isn't the right sensitivity setting, even though the config file says so.

I have disabled mouse accell and set it to ignore windows sensitivity.

A reinstall will probably fix it

  • 2 weeks later...

Go to your portal folder where the config file and create a new .cfg file named autoexec.cfg, then, in-game, open the console and type exec autoexec

It worked for me having the same problem with CS: GO
